Description

Basket - A simple plastic version of the classic Bidayuh ‘tambok’., with circular top and square base. Vertical 1:1 weave. Nylon carrying cord strung through thin plastic loops at the top and bottom.

Context (CMS Context)
(Bio): Liana C.L. Chua, female collector Sold at the Main Bazaar, Kuching. Kuching’s Main Bazaar is the city’s main tourist shopping stretch, filled with souvenir shops, art and antique galleries and travel agents. Bought from a shop selling a large array of plastic basketry. A good example of how older weaving techniques and motifs have adapted to new materials. Price is roughly equivalent to or cheaper than a similar object made in a local village.
